Microwave sintering of nanobarium titanate

Nanosized BaTiO3 powder was synthesized at 160 deg. C/45 min using the Microwave Hydrothermal (M-H) system. The nanopowder was characterized using X-ray diffraction, transmission electron microscopy, infrared spectroscopy and differential scanning calorimetry. The as-synthesized powder was microwave sintered at 950, 1050 and 1150 deg. C/30 min in air and for the comparison the nanopowder was also conventionally sintered at 1250 deg. C/3 h in air
